﻿#carreerscenterbanner
{
	height:268px;
   clear:both;
	/*background-image:url(/SiteCollectionImages/Careers_PlaceHolder.gif);*/
   /*background-position:center;
   background-position:top center ;   */
   background-position:center top;
   text-align:center;
   background-repeat:no-repeat;
  
   
}
/******************************************************/
#careescenterbannercontent
{
	margin:auto;
	text-align:left;
	width:860px;
	height: 107px;
}
#careescenterbannercontent .leftcolumn
{
	color:#d1cbcb;
	font-size:27px;
	font-family:Arial;
	font-weight:bold;
	vertical-align:text-top;
	padding:0px; 
	height:40px;
	float:left;
	width:105px;	
	margin-top:67px; 
	letter-spacing:1px;
	margin-left:2px;
}
.careersbannertitle
{

	/*color:White;
	font-size:27px;
	font-family:Arial;
	font-weight:bold;
	vertical-align:text-top;
	padding:0px; 
	height:40px;
	float:left;	
	position:absolute;		
	z-index:9998;
	top:308px;*/
	color:White;
	font-size:27px;
	font-family:Arial;
	font-weight:bold;
	position:relative;
	z-index:23;
	*z-index:200!important; 
	width:860px;
	
	text-align:left;
	margin:0px auto 0px auto;
	padding-top:220px;

}
*+html .careersbannertitle
{
	color:White;
	font-size:27px;
	font-family:Arial;
	font-weight:bold;
	vertical-align:text-top;
	padding:0px; 
	height:40px;
	/*float:left;*/
	position:absolute;
	MARGIN-TOP: 0px;

	z-index:9997;
	bottom:5px; 
	}


#careescenterbannercontent .textcontent
{
	padding:0px;
	width:400px;
	height:160px; 
	float:right;
	margin-top:167px;
	/*border:solid 1px white;*/
    /*vertical-align:middle;*/
		
}
/*******************************************************/
.calltoaction
{
     width:167px;
     height:30px;
     background-color:#315E9D;
     margin-top:1px;
     
     padding-left:15px;
     padding-right:15px;
     
     padding-top:10px;
      padding-bottom:10px;
      color:White;
      font-size:12px;
}
.careerswebparttext
{
	width:197px;
     padding-top:20px;
     padding-bottom:20px;
     
}
.careersrightcontentRow1PicDesc1
{
	 margin-left:10px;
	margin-top:10px;
	padding-bottom:8px;
}
.featuretext
{
	float :right;
	margin-right:40px;
	margin-top:190px;
	color:White;
	width:350px;	 
	 z-index:1;
	 position:absolute;
	 padding-left:430px;
	 
	 
	
}
*+html .featuretext
{
	float :right;
	margin-right:40px;
	margin-top:78px;
	color:White;
	width:350px;	 
	 z-index:1;
	 position:absolute;
	 padding-left:430px;
	
}


.featuretext .featuretexttitle
{
    font-weight:bold;
    font-size:16px;
    margin-bottom:15px;
}
.featuretext .sencondtitle
{
    
    font-size:14px;
}
.maincontentrighttop
{
	background-color:#DDE5F1;
	 width:200px;
	 color:#0066C3;
	 font-weight:bold;
	 
	 
}
.maincontentrighttop a:link
{
    font-weight:bold;
    color:white;
}
.maincontentrighttop a:visited
{
    font-weight:bold;
    color:white;

}
.maincontentrighttop a:hover
{
    font-weight:bold;
    color:red;

}
.maincontentrighttop ul
{
	list-style:none; 
    margin-left:0px;
    margin-bottom:0px;
    padding-left:0px;
}
.maincontentrighttop ul li
{
    border-top:solid 1px #C7D3E5;
    padding-left:16px;
    height:18px;
    padding-top:4px;
		
}

.maincontentrighttop .firstitem
{
	border-top:solid 0px #C7D3E5;
    padding-left:16px;
    height:18px;
    padding-top:0px;
    *padding-top:4px!important;
 	margin-top:-9px;
 	*margin-top:0px;
}
.maincontentrighttop .currentitem
{
    background-color:#192F59;
    color:White;
}
.maincontentrighttop .currentitem a:visited
{
    color:White;
}


.careersblank
{
    background-color:White;
    height:20px;
    }
/*********************leftwebpart*******************************/
.leftwebpart
{
	
	
	float:left;
	width:197px;
	margin-top:30px;
	

    
}
.leftwebpart .headerimg
{
	
	 width:197px;
	 height:99px;
	 background-image:url(../../);
	 cursor:pointer;   
}
.headerimg .headertitle
{
	font-size:17px;
	font-family:Arial;
	font-weight:bold;
	padding:15px;
	color:#FFFFFF;
}
/***********************end leftwebpart**************************/

/***********************midwebpart*******************************/
.midwebpart
{
	
	
	float:left;
	margin-left:10px;
	width:197px;
	
	margin-top:30px;

}
.midwebpart .headerimg
{
	width:197px;
	 height:99px;
	background-image:url(../../);
	cursor:pointer;
}

/***********************end midwebpart**************************/

/***********************rightwebpart****************************/
.rightwebpart
{
	
	
	float:left;
	margin-left:10px;
	width:197px;
margin-top:30px;

	
}
.rightwebpart .headerimg
{
	width:197px;
	 height:99px;
	 background-image:url(../../);
	cursor:pointer;
}

/***********************end rightwebpart***********************/
.careerswebparttext 
{
	font-size:12px;
	font-family:Arial;
}
.careerswebparttext p
{
	margin-bottom:10px;
}
.careerswebparttext p a
{
	padding-top:10px;
}

.maincontentwebpart
{
	width:620px;
    margin-top:19px !important;
    margin-top:10px;
	 /*overflow:hidden;*/
}